    For the recorded music, only the bassist changes. James Hetfield is rhythm guitar and vocals (yes, at the same time), Lars Ulrich on and off the drums (he likes to jump around on stage), Kirk Hammett on lead guitar (95% of the solo work), and then the bassists are, start to finish, Cliff Burton (may he be resting peacefully... died in a bus accident on tour), Jason Newsted, and Robert Trujillo... 1986 and 2001.
